EBA Launches Call For Papers For Its 2019 Policy Research Workshop
Date 15/03/2019
The European Banking Authority (EBA) launches today a call for research papers in view of the 2019 Policy Research Workshop taking place on 27-28 November 2019 in Paris on the topic "The future of stress tests in the banking sector – approaches, governance and methodologies". The submission deadline is 12 July 2019.

SEC Staff To Hold Fintech Forum To Discuss Distributed Ledger Technology And Digital Assets - Forum To Be Held On May 31 At SEC Headquarters
Date 15/03/2019
The Securities and Exchange Commission today announced that its staff will host a public forum focusing on distributed ledger technology (DLT) and digital assets on May 31, 2019. The forum is being organized by the agency’s Strategic Hub for Innovation and Financial Technology (FinHub) and was announced in connection with the launch of FinHub last year.

US Federal Agencies Adopt Interim Final Rule To Facilitate Transfers Of Legacy Swaps
Date 15/03/2019
Five federal agencies today acted to ensure that qualifying swaps may be transferred from a United Kingdom (UK) entity to an affiliate in the European Union (EU) or the United States without triggering new margin requirements. The action is in response to the possibility of a non-negotiated withdrawal of the UK from the EU. This action applies to legacy swaps that were entered into before applicable regulatory margin requirements took effect and is generally consistent with similar relief contemplated by international jurisdictions.

CFTC To Hold An Open Commission Meeting On March 25
Date 15/03/2019
Commodity Futures Trading Commission (CFTC) Chairman J. Christopher Giancarlo announced that the CFTC will hold an open meeting on Monday, March 25, 2019, at 10:00 a.m. to consider the following:
-
Amendment to the Comparability Determination for Japan: Margin Requirements for Uncleared Swaps for Swap Dealers and Major Swap Participants;
-
Comparability Determination for Australia: Margin Requirements for Uncleared Swaps for Swap Dealers and Major Swap Participants;
-
Final Rule Amending Regulations on Segregation of Assets Held as Collateral in Uncleared Swap Transactions;
-
Final Rule Regarding the De Minimis Exception to the Swap Dealer Definition – Swaps Entered into by Insured Depository Institutions in Connection with Loans to Customers
-
Final Rule Regarding Financial Surveillance Examination Program Requirements for Self-Regulatory Organizations
-
Brexit-Related Updates to Memoranda of Understanding and Related Side Letters with the United Kingdom Financial Conduct Authority; and
-
Interim Final Rule Regarding Margin Requirements for Uncleared Swaps for Swap Dealers and Major Swap Participants in Light of Brexit
